Output d74907888b5217fc3eb01f931c336ec4eba99441dd68b3a70c2828d68e875db5:0

value
1768000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8488ccce09261f0f79631e20d30dff3b6c58ba96 OP_EQUALVERIFY OP_CHECKSIG
address
1D5n5MWNnCozwwgHSYvfcHzYrgPdXA1F2v
transaction
d74907888b5217fc3eb01f931c336ec4eba99441dd68b3a70c2828d68e875db5
confirmations
579270
spent
true